research in Australia found 88 per cent prevalence, and values are similarly high in Europe.[7] Sixty-six per cent of women prisoners reportedly also smoke during pregnancy.[8] Smoking by prison staff is largely unexplored and very little data is available, although some studies show that the prevalence rates of staff smoking in detention facilities are higher than or comparable to those of the general population.[9] Staff smoking should systematically be addressed in tobacco control policies in prisons, as part of a wider approach promoting health in the workplace
